The Master Course of Media Engagement & Communication

The ability to communicate effectively in professional settings is an essential skill in today’s world, whether you are giving a business presentation to potential clients, presenting in front of a large audience, or interacting with the media. According to studies, 74% of people have a fear of public speaking and 92% feel tense before interviews. However, with the right skills and techniques, anyone can become a confident, effective and persuasive speaker. 


In this course, we delve deep into the world of communication, where every word carries the potential for power, credibility, and legacy. You will master the skills necessary to position yourself as a respected voice of authority, deliver effective speeches that leave a lasting impact on your audience, and build positive relationships with the media.


We also recognize that communication is the bridge that connects diverse cultures, languages and customs. You will expand your understanding of the intricacies of intercultural communication and learn how to effectively communicate with people from different cultural backgrounds in order to avoid confusion and misunderstandings. 


By the end of this course, you will be able to apply your intercultural competence to professional settings in order to maximize collaboration, productivity and business development.

Conflict is part of the human experience. It is universal and inevitable. As the proverb goes, “Where there are people, there is conflict.” However, through effective communication, conflicts can be transformed into a powerful source of collaboration and cooperation.

 

In this course, we’ll explore the various types of conflict that can arise, the common communication pitfalls that can escalate conflicts, and the effective strategies for resolving conflicts through clear and respectful communication. We’ll delve deep into human emotions and learn how to navigate disagreement, discord and conflict. Tapping into the collective knowledge of the world’s cultures and traditions, this course will equip you to become a skilled negotiator and effective communicator who can find mutually beneficial solutions in any situation.


By the end of this course, you will be able to:


  • Identify the role perception plays in how we communicate
  • Identify sources of misunderstanding, differences and conflict in various settings
  • Utilize competitive, collaborative, compromising, accommodating and avoiding techniques
  • Handle people with tact and diplomacy
  • Bridge cultural gaps in communication through the use of microskills
  • Influence others and negotiate effectively

Communication is the currency of business success. The modern business world is fast-paced and competitive. The success of a company depends not only on the quality of its products or services but also on its ability to communicate effectively in order to develop a devoted client base and connect with employees. Productivity has been proven to improve by up to 25% in organizations with connected employees. Businesses with effective communication practices are more than 50% more likely to report employee turnover levels below the industry average.


In this course, you’ll learn how to speak and write corporate communication fluently, including how to manage internal and external communication channels, maximize the effectiveness of your messaging, and optimize the public perception of your business.


By the end of this course, you will be able to:

  • Develop and implement effective corporate communication strategies
  • Manage internal and external communication channels
  • Understand and apply branding and reputation management principles
  • Adapt tone, rhetoric and delivery for different cultural contexts

Communication is the bridge that connects diverse cultures, languages and customs. Culture, in turn, influences how people communicate, including their language, gestures, facial expressions, social norms, and writing styles. Understanding and effectively navigating cultural differences can build strong relationships, promote collaboration, and avoid misunderstandings.


In this course, we will tour the complexities of communication in our globalized world. You will expand your understanding of the intricacies of intercultural communication and learn how to effectively communicate with people from different cultural backgrounds. You will also learn how to apply your intercultural competence to professional settings in order to maximize collaboration, productivity and business development.

 

By the end of this course, you will be able to:


  • Understand the impact of culture on communication styles
  • Navigate cultural differences in verbal and written communication
  • Develop strategies for effective communication across cultural boundaries
  • Identify and challenge stereotypes, biases, and sources of intercultural conflict that can hinder effective communication

Journalism and article writing skills are more important than ever in today’s world, where access to information is unlimited and readers demand high-quality, engaging content. As a journalist, you have the power to inform, educate and inspire people through your writing. As the proverb goes, “The pen is mightier than the sword” – and this is especially true in the world of journalism. 


In this course, we will explore the various types of text, each with its own unique target group, purpose and style. You will learn how to develop a journalistic copy that informs the reader in such a way that they are able to form a solid decision about an event or situation. You will also acquire the skills needed to craft compelling print media that establishes you as a credible source of authority for continued reader engagement.


  

By the end of this course, you will be able to:


  • Craft short, compelling sentences in the active voice
  • Apply the right tone of voice and style for the medium and target audience
  • Develop strong interviewing skills and the ability to source relationships
  • Generate newsworthy angles
  • Work effectively with editors and other professionals in print media

 Public relations and strategic communication are essential skills for corporate, government and non-profit sectors. As one of the top ten in demand professions globally, employment of public relations specialists is projected to grow 8% from 2021 to 2031, faster than the average for all other occupations. 


In this course, we will master what it takes to become highly sought after in the field of public relations and strategic communication. You will learn how to create captivating written, video, social media, and campaign content. You will expand your ability to build and maintain positive relationships with stakeholders and the public, and guide organizations through the complex and ever-changing landscape of communication.


By the end of this course, you will be able to:


  • Plan and execute effective communication strategies
  • Conduct audience research and set communication objectives
  • Write effective press releases, feature articles, speeches, and online content
  • Build and maintain cooperative relationships with clients and media outlets
  • Master the fundamentals of public relations communications, including: a well-tooled press kit, news releases, annual reports, newsletters and brochures
  • Apply ethical principles to public relations and strategic communication practices

As the proverb goes, “The pen is mightier than the sword.” The ability to write clearly and effectively is one of the most important skills you can have today. When harnessed correctly, words have the power to uplift and enlighten, to bridge cultural differences, and to help you thrive in the business world. Not only is writing a beautiful art form that allows us to express ourselves, but data also shows that 73% of employers look for writing as a top skill in the workplace. In fact, written communication has been ranked #3 in the most-desired qualities.


In this course, we will master the essential skills needed for writing paragraphs, emails, essays, business reports, letters and other communications. We will explore the intricacies of the writing process and delve into the art of crafting compelling prose. You will boost your confidence in your writing, write more effectively, and open the door to endless new career opportunities.


By the end of this course, you will be able to:


  • Write effective briefs, business reports, emails and communication
  • Craft engaging stories in your own unique writing voice
  • Develop content strategies for the web, digital media, and marketing
  • Avoid common pitfalls and mistakes, including grammar, punctuation and style errors
